Behind the counter at the Black Cat
The Black Cat's Food for Thought cafe feeds bands and fans alike every day. The menu's filled with meat, vegetarian, and vegan items, including fresh baked goods by the café's owner. TBD photographer Joshua Yospyn got a backstage look at operations in the kitchen this past weekend.

The worst restaurant websites in Washington, D.C.
We all know what makes a bad restaurant website: Flash animation, auto-play music, PDF menus, garish colors, flash photography, comical fonts, and labyrinthine navigation. There are too many sites like this to count. But the local restaurants on these lists, where we focused our search, ought to know better.
